Postdoctoral Project

Ecological functions of secondary forests and their role in stream conservation in agricultural landscapes of the Brazilian Amazon

 

The objective of this proposal is to evaluate the role of secondary forests in providing important ecological functions for the structure and functioning of stream ecosystems, such as supply of trunks (important for the formation of habitats and conservation of biodiversity) and maintenance of levels of decomposition. foliar (important for the maintenance of heterotrophic metabolism in streams). For this, different sets of data collected in two regions of the Brazilian Amazon will be used. From the results obtained, it is expected to obtain important new information for the management of riparian forests in agricultural landscapes.
